Output 21e307edd4ecf5df1c24f63be985c237835decaa1f8f5ee38fa7fde2c66cc3c8:1

value
17891
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88ae15d33e347314463680ae7dd1dbe101e7a868 OP_EQUALVERIFY OP_CHECKSIG
address
1DThSkBR2v4RsANrot9HMquqrvicf6Yg3n
transaction
21e307edd4ecf5df1c24f63be985c237835decaa1f8f5ee38fa7fde2c66cc3c8
confirmations
444671
spent
true